Costs You Can Expect — Roof and Solar

Costs vary a lot based on roof size, pitch, complexity, materials, and solar system capacity. Below is a realistic cost table for average Charlotte homes to help set expectations. These numbers are industry-based estimates as of early 2026 and include labor, materials, and standard disposal. They do not include local permitting fees or unique structural upgrades which can add to the bill.

Service Typical Cost Range (Charlotte) Average Installed Cost Notes
Asphalt shingle roof (full replacement, 2,000 sq ft) $7,500 – $14,000 $10,200 Most common option; architectural shingles.
Metal roof (standing seam, 2,000 sq ft) $14,000 – $28,000 $19,500 Longer lifespan; higher upfront cost.
Solar system (6 kW to 8 kW, pre-incentive) $15,000 – $28,000 $21,000 (7 kW sample) Depends on panel/inverter brands and roof complexity.
Combined roofing + solar bundle $22,000 – $40,000 $29,000 Bundling can save on labor and coordination costs.

Financing, Incentives, and Net Cost

A big factor in affordability is the federal Investment Tax Credit (ITC) which, as of 2026, typically covers 30% of the eligible solar system cost for residential installations. Some local utilities or municipalities may run rebates or performance-based incentives at varying times, and Charlotte homeowners should check current Duke Energy North Carolina programs or municipal offers. Financing through loans or leases is often available; loan terms and APRs will dramatically alter monthly payments and total interest paid.

Here’s a sample financing and incentive illustration for a 7 kW solar system priced at $21,000 pre-incentive:

Item Amount Notes
Solar system cost (installed) $21,000 7 kW example
Federal ITC (30%) -$6,300 Tax credit applied to tax liability
Estimated net cost $14,700 Does not include local rebates
Typical financed monthly payment (10-year loan, 4.99% APR) ~$155/month Principal + interest estimate

Warranties and Guarantees — What to Expect

Roofing XL & Solar advertises combined workmanship and product warranties, but the specifics depend on the contract. Below is a breakdown of typical warranty coverage you should confirm in writing. Pay special attention to the duration and whether the warranty is transferable if you sell your home.

Coverage Type Typical Duration What It Covers Common Exclusions
Roofing manufacturer warranty 25 – 50 years (material dependent) Shingle defects and premature failure Improper installation (unless covered by workmanship)
Workmanship warranty (contractor) 5 – 10 years Installation errors, flashing, leaks Damage from neglect, storms if not covered by insurance
Solar panel warranty 25 years (performance) Power output degradation guarantees Physical damage, unauthorized tampering
Inverter warranty 5 – 12 years (extendable) Inverter hardware failures Non-approved software changes

Installation Process and Timeline

A typical combined roof-and-solar project from Roofing XL & Solar follows a sequence: initial inspection and measurements, system design, permitting, roofing work (if needed), solar racking and electrical work, and final inspection and interconnection with the utility. For an average job in Charlotte, expect the timeline to run between 4 and 10 weeks from signed contract to final interconnection.

Roof replacement typically takes 2 to 5 days for an average single-family home, while the solar installation itself may take 1 to 3 days once the roof and mounts are ready. Permitting and final utility hookup often create the largest time variance — permits can take 1–3 weeks and utility interconnect approval another 1–4 weeks depending on backlog.

Energy Savings, Production Estimates, and Payback

Charlotte has moderate solar resource levels. A well-sited solar array in the Charlotte metro area typically produces around 1,250–1,400 kWh per installed kW per year depending on orientation and shading. Below is a sample production and payback table for a 7 kW system, assuming a household electric rate of $0.13/kWh and current federal tax incentives.

Metric Value Notes
System size 7 kW Typical for an average household
Annual production ~9,100 kWh Using 1,300 kWh/kW/year estimate
Annual electricity savings ~$1,183 9,100 kWh × $0.13/kWh
Net system cost after 30% ITC $14,700 From earlier example
Estimated simple payback ~12.4 years $14,700 / $1,183 per year
Expected useful life 25+ years Panels often keep producing past warranty terms

Remember that payback improves if energy prices rise, if you qualify for state/local incentives, or if you can use more of the solar energy onsite (e.g., with electric vehicles or heat pumps). If you’re replacing an old roof and would have paid for that anyway, bundling solar installation during a roof replacement can make the combined economics more attractive.

How to Vet a Roofing + Solar Contractor

Before signing, get a detailed written contract that includes job scope, material specs, brand names, system production estimates, timeline milestones, permit responsibilities, warranty language, payment schedule, and who is responsible for warranty service if subcontractors were used. Ask for local references, check licensing and insurance, and confirm whether the company will handle the interconnection paperwork with Duke Energy or if you need to file anything yourself. Finally, check how change orders are handled and what triggers extra charges.

Maintenance Tips After Installation

Maintenance for combined roof-and-solar projects is straightforward but important. Keep panels free of heavy debris and large overhanging branches. Inspect roof penetrations and flashing annually, and ask for an inspection after any major storm. Keep documentation of all maintenance and any service calls — these records help with warranty claims or future resale. Solar systems typically need very little active upkeep; in most cases, an annual visual check and inverter status review are sufficient.

How to Get the Most from Your Quote

Ask for an itemized quote that lists material brands, panel models, inverter models, racking type, roof deck repairs (if any), removal and disposal, permit fees, and interconnection handling. Request production estimates with shading analyses and a clear explanation of performance assumptions. Finally, ask the installer to walk you through the warranty paperwork and service escalation path so you know who to call and what documentation you’ll need in the event of a claim.
